RNAIPL conserves 50,000 liters of water daily

Renault Nissan Automotive India Private Limited (RNAIPL) plant in Oragadam, Chennai, is now conserving a daily 50,000 litres (50 kilolitres) of water from its sewage treatment plant by using a decanter facility recently installed on its premises. The facility, which separates water from sewage waste, is mitigating water wastage and reducing water demand for RNAIPL’s industrial operations. The 50 kilolitres conserved are in addition to water savings from RNAIPL’s many water sustainability initiatives implemented at the plant. Tata Motors’ commercial vehicles’ price increases from 1st July 2022

India’s largest commercial vehicle manufacturer Tata Motors has announced an impending price hike of its commercial vehicle range. An increase in price in the range of 1.5-2.5%, will come into effect from 1st July 2022 across the range, depending upon individual model and variant. While the company takes extensive measures to absorb a significant portion of the increased input costs, at various levels of manufacturing, the steep rise in overall input costs makes it imperative to pass on a residual proportion via a minimized price hike.

West Bengal registers 1,822 new cases, positivity rate at 14.10 percent

West Bengal recorded 1,822 new COVID-19 fresh Covid cases on Sunday, recording a positivity rate of 14.10 %, as per the state Health Department. 3 more COVID-19 sufferers died, taking the toll to 21,225. The state currently has 10,583 active cases. 304 of these patients had to be admitted to the hospital. The new cases were called after 12,921 samples were tested. The country has so far reported 20,34,485 cases of COVID-19. A total of 20,02,677 patients have recovered, including 526 in the remaining 24 hours.
